Q: Is 452,021,016 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 452,021,016 is a composite number.

Why is 452,021,016 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 452,021,016 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 8 12 24 2,003 4,006 6,009 8,012 9,403 12,018 16,024 18,806 24,036 28,209 37,612 48,072 56,418 75,224 112,836 225,672 18,834,209 37,668,418 56,502,627 75,336,836 113,005,254 150,673,672 226,010,508 and 452,021,016, with no remainder.

Since 452,021,016 cannot be divided by just 1 and 452,021,016, it is a composite number.
